The Office of Homelessness Prevention Administration (HPA) works to keep New Yorkers in their homes. HPA works with the Department of Homeless Services (DHS), the NYC Housing Authority (NYCHA) and many other organizations and City agencies to assist families and individuals in need in obtaining and maintaining stable, affordable housing.

Under managerial direction, with wide latitude for the exercise of independent judgment and initiative, serves an Administrative Job Opportunity Specialist NM-II, to function as the Director of the Rental Subsidies, over the Renewal and Review Conference units within the Homelessness Prevention Administration (HPA)/ Legal Initiatives/Rental Assistance.

The Rental Assistance/Subsidies Program manages the ongoing payment and administration of the Living in Communities (LINC) rental assistance programs for homeless families. The Renewal unit oversees the annual renewal of LINC subsidies. The Review Conference unit responds to inquiries and complaints from participant regarding specific Rental Assistance decisions. Staff also address requests for information and review conferences as well as inquiries and service requests from LINC landlords, tenants, and community advocates.

The Department of Social Services’ PREVENTION COMMUNITY SUPPORT/HOMEBASE/ PREVENTION CONTRACTS is recruiting for one (1) ADMIN JOB OPPORTUNITY SPEC NM (NON-MGRL) II to function as the RENEWAL & REVIEW CONFERENCE UNIT DIRECTOR.

The RENEWAL & REVIEW CONFERENCE UNIT DIRECTOR will:

- Direct, coordinate and monitor the performance of the staff in the Renewal and Review Conference units within the Rental Assistance program to ensure adherence to the goals, policies, and performance standards of the Homelessness Prevention Administration, as well as HRA, including ensuring that staff are properly assigned, receive proper training, and are properly evaluated.

- Assist in the development and formulation of corrective action plans involving the Renewal and Review Conference units within the Rental Assistance program, which may include the development of new procedures, appropriate policy directives and bulletins and additional staff training, to ensure the elimination of deficit areas and directs follow-up studies to ensure that corrective actions have been taken and that new procedures have been properly implemented.

- Intercede when supervisory staff alerts of any matters needing a higher level of involvement.

- Liaise with appropriate governmental and non-governmental entities including New York City Housing Court judges, city agencies such as the Department of Homeless Services, the Department of Housing, Preservation and Development and the New York City Housing Authority, elected officials, and non-governmental housing and homeless service providers and community-based organizations in order to expedite the meeting of critical Agency needs.

- Participate, through findings based on the review of data from a variety of sources including WMS, POS, RAD, CARES, NYCWAY, RADMS and MIS, and through the evaluation of Agency reports as well as reports of other government and non-profit institutions, in the formulation and analysis of policy issues as they relate to the Renewal and Review Conference units within the Rental Assistance program.

- Assure the integrity of the Review Conference process, leading staff, monitoring and controlling the services provided to ensure work efforts and performance fulfills the vision /mission of the program and adheres to guidelines, procedures and policy.

Qualification Requirements

1. A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college or university, plus four years of satisfactory full-time experience performing work related to providing employment related services or economic support services to persons in need, at least eighteen months of this experience must have been in a supervisory or managerial capacity; or

2. A four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ent and eight years of full-time experience equivalent to "1" above; at least eighteen months of this experience must have been in a supervisory or managerial capacity; or

3. Education and/or experience equivalent to "1" or "2" above. College credits from an accredited college or university may be substituted for experience on the basis of 30 semester credits for one year; year of work experience. However, all candidates must have at least a four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ent and at least eighteen months of experience must have been in a supervisory or managerial capacity as described in "1" above.
